GENERAL DESCRIPTION
The MSM7661B is an LSI device which converts digitally sampled NTSC or PAL video signals to 8-bit format based on ITU-RBT601. The input video signals available are composite video signals and S video signals. The composite video signals are converted to YUV data via a 2-dimensional Y/C separation circuit. The A-to-D converted data is data sampled at pixel clock frequency or double pixel clock frequency (the built-in decimation filter is used). Input signal synchronization can lock synchronization and color burst at high speed through internal digital processing. The MSM7661B is upward compatible with the MSM7661. It provides additional features which are added to the MSM7661 indicated by the mark n and is superior to the MSM7661 in picture quality and synchronization stability. The device, which includes an additional register added to the MSM7661, has electrical characteristics which are nearly equal to those of the MSM7661. The MSM7661B allows a pin-for-pin replacement with the MSM7661.

BLOCK DESCRIPTION
1. Prologue Block
The prologue block performs Y/C separation by inputting data. Data can be input either at ordinary pixel frequency (ITU-R : 13.5 MHz) or at double pixel frequency (ITU-R: 27 MHz). When the double pixel frequency is used, data is processed after changing to the ordinary pixel frequency via a decimeter circuit. By changing the register setting, the decimeter circuit can be bypassed irrespective of whether data is input at ordinary pixel frequency or at double pixel frequency. The prologue block performs Y/C separation using a 2-dimensional adaptive comb filter when composite signals (CVBS) are input. The following operation modes can be changed via the I2C-bus. The * mark indicates a default. The default is a state that is selected when reset. 1) Video input mode select Composite video input * S video input 2) Video input mode select Auto NTSC/PAL select* (Only for ITU-R601) Dependent on Operation mode selected When ITU-R601 is selected, the video input mode is automatically determined by the number of lines per field. 3) Operation mode select NTSC CCIR601 MTSC Square Pixel NTSC 4Fsc PAL CCIR601 PAL Square Pixel 4) Decimeter circuit pass/bypass select Decimeter circuit is passed. * Decimeter circuit is bypassed. 5) Y/C separation mode select Adaptive comb filter is used. * Unadaptive comb filter is used. Trap filter is used. The adaptive comb filter detects the correlation up to 3 lines between continuous lines. The Y/ C is separated by the comb filter according to the way of correlation if theses lines are correlated. The Y/C is separated by the trap filter if these lines are not correlated (only 2 lines in the case of PAL). In the unadaptive comb filter, the Y/C is always separated by removing the luminance component based on the average of preceding and following lines (when there is the correlation between 3 lines).

If the comb filter is not used, the Y/C is separated by the trap filter. The Y/C separation circuit is bypassed by S video signal input. In adittion, the functions of this block work only when lines are valid as image information. The processing of CVBS signals is not made during V-blanking. 2. Luminance Block
The luminance block removes synchronous signals from the signals containing luminance components after Y/C separation. The signals are corrected and output as luminance signals. The luminance signal output level gain control functions include three selectable modes such as AGC (Auto Gain Control), MGC (manual Gain Control) + No Clamp, and MGC + Pedestal Clamp. In the AGC mode, the luminance level amplification is determined by comparing the depth of SYNC with the reference value. The default is 40IRE which can be changed by the register. The input is a sync chip clamp type. In the MGC + No Clamp mode, the luminance signal output level is not affected by the input, and the amplification and black level are controlled by setting the register. In the MGC + Pedestal Clamp mode, the signal output level is clamped to the pedestal level of the input. The signal amplification and black level are controllable from the clamped point by setting the register. Chrominance Block
This is a chroma signal processing block. The following modes can be selected. 1) Use of color bandpass filter Used* Not used 2) ACC loop filter time constant select Slow Medium Fast Fixed 3) ACC reference level fine adjustment 4) Parameter for burst level fine adjustment The threshold level for valid chroma amplitude is selected based on a color burst ratio. 0.5 0.25* 0.125 off 5) Color killer mode select Auto color killer mode* Forcible color killer 6) Parameter for color subcarrier phase fine adjustment In this block, chroma signals pass through the chroma bandpass filter to cut an unnecessary band. To maintain a constant chroma level, UV demodulation is performed on these signals via the ACC correction circuit. (This filter can be bypassed.) If the demodulation result does not reach a specified level, color killer signals are generated to fix the ACC gain. This functions as an auto color killer control circuit. The UV demodulation result is output as chrominance signals via a low pass filter.

I2C BUS FORMAT
The I2C-bus interface input format is shown below.
S Slave Address Symbol S Slave Address A Subaddress Data n P Start condition Slave address 1000001X, 8th bit is write signal. Acknowledge. Generated by slave Subaddress byte Data to write to address designated by subaddress. Stop condition A Subaddress A Data 0 A ...... Data n A P
Description
As mentioned above, the write operation can be executed from subaddress to subaddress continuously. When the write operation is executed at subaddresses discontinuously, the Acknowledge and Stop condition formats are input repeatedly after Data 0. If one of the following matters occurs, the decoder will not return "A" (Acknowledge). * The slave address does not match. * A non-existent subaddress is specified. * The write attribute of a register does not match "X" (read/write control bit). OPERATION CLOCK SETTING
The operation clock settings at ITU-R601 are shown below.
Input clock 27.0 MHz 27.0 MHz 13.5 MHz Input data 27.0 MHz 13.5 MHz 13.5 MHz CLKSEL Pin "L" "L" "H" Register (MRB2) "0" (decimation filter used) "1" (Unused) "1" (Unused) Clock for A/D converter CLKX2O (27 MHz) CLKXO (13.5 MHz) CLKX2O or CLKXO (13.5 MHz)
When the double speed clock is used, data can be input at a double speed or at an ordinary speed by setting the internal register (MRB2) and the clock for the A/D converter. The internal processing after decimation filter is performed at an ordinary speed.
